Comments about Blu Dot Modu-licious #1:
I needed a small piece of furniture to serve as a media storage cabinet as well as a place for my Apple TV (the little black box) to sit. The location is small and adjacent to a window, both width and depth limited. The Modu-licious #1 was almost the correct size for the space. Assembly was straight forward after I oriented the pieces correctly. The steel drawer fronts are thick and substantial. The draw glides actions are slightly stiff when completely closing the draw. I like the look of the red and gray drawers with the light maple wood. I wish it was about $100 cheaper, then I would consider it a steel (steal)!
